Add the ability to lock states, provinces, cultures, and religions: refactoring (#910)
* Add the ability to lock states, provinces, cultures, and religions (#902) * Add the basis for locking everything, code and test the culture locking * Got the religion generator working, but not the tree. There are cycles being generated * Religions work now, including the tree view * Got the states and provinces working as well, all good and ready * Refresh the province editor when regenerating * Implement the versioning steps * Fix the state naming and color changing even when locked * The fix did not work with loaded maps, fix that too * Fix a few more bugs and address the PR feedback * Fix the state expanding event when they're locked bug * Implement some logic to ignore state being locked when regenerating provinces directly. * refactor(#902): start with states regenertion * refactor(#902): locked states cells to be assigned on start * refactor(#902): lock state - keep label * refactor(#902): lock provinces * refactor(#902): regenerate states - update provinces * refactor(#902): regenerate cultures * refactor(#902): regenerate religions Co-authored-by: Guillaume St-Pierre <gstpierre01@gmail.com> Co-authored-by: Azgaar <maxganiev@yandex.com>
